Sam Asghari, the ex-husband of Britney Spears, flaunted his toned body in a recent Instagram photo that showed him getting ready for the Hollywood Beauty Awards. Some fans think this is a thirst trap though, and a sign that he's moving on from Britney Spears lightning fast. Is he ready to date again?

The 29-year-old actor was shown in the video, which he posted to social media early on Monday, standing fully nude while getting his hair washed.

The American-Iranian model, who has been on shows including Black Monday and Hacks, then wrapped a white towel tightly around his toned chest. The video continued to show the celebrity wearing a Balmain suit after brushing his teeth and kissing his dog, Porsha, on the head.

Asghari looked totally at ease as he walked the red carpet, posing for photographers and giving bystanders a warm thumbs up. Just one month ago, a source informed Us Weekly that his ex-wife 'feels manipulated and misled by Sam' after their 13-month marriage ended recently.

This is when he made his post. As the couple proceeds with their official separation, the insider disclosed that Spears is starting to accept her single status. "Britney's top priority when it comes to dating seems to be meeting hot guys and enjoying her freedom," the person stated.

It's challenging to predict Britney's true desires in the future because they shift so frequently. Despite being well-known for having disagreements with many of her relatives regarding her conservatorship, she is now thinking about getting back in touch with some of them after her marriage fell apart.

Meanwhile, Sam Asghari has defended Britney Spears despite their contentious breakup, claiming that the singer was used by Donald Trump Jr., the former president's son, to score political points.

The outspoken critic was tagged by the Iranian-born model on Instagram, who said, "It's not okay to be a bully."

By posting a side-by-side photo comparison of the Grammy winner, the 45-year-old expressed his opinions against the Toxic hitmaker, prompting this response. The pop icon's most recent, slightly grainy photo of herself holding a knife appeared on the right, with the words "America under Biden" displayed above. Meanwhile, an earlier picture of Britney appeared on the left, in which she was seen wearing a skirt and a short T-shirt and credited the image to "America under Trump."

The politician-turned-businessman nodded, captioning the meme, "Yup."
